Here we go then .... but first, you need to realise that the Welsh alphabet is a bit different to ours ...here it is ... A B C CH D DD E F FF G NG H I J L LL M N O P PH R RH S T TH U W Y So ... here's my solution .... [1] Pibydd goesgoch brith Spotted Redshank [2] Yswidw gynffon hir Long-tailed Tit [3] Mulfran werdd Shag [4] Aderyn â phig mawr Toucan ( bird with a big beak !) [5] Llunos Ffrongoch Redpoll [6] Math o aderyn rhydd Godwit [7] Tinwen y Garreg Wheatear ( white-arse of the Rock !)) [8] Jac y do Jackdaw ( J is a rarely used Welsh + I needed the "c") IS-NODIADAU .. [1] Exactly why there is a Welsh word for Toucan I don't know. [2] Tinwen y Garreg is only there for the "t" ...surely I can get it somewhere else. I can't count the one in brith or math ... they're glued to the h. [3] #6 starts with "math o" = "sort of" ... .. and ends with "rhydd" = liberal, free, loose" ... .. I wonder if they meant " rhudd" = red ? .....
